The relocated populations, often referred to as the “Three Gorges migrants,” were resettled in various places, primarily as follows:  Local Resettlement:  Some migrants remained close to the Three Gorges reservoir area, resettling on nearby higher ground or in areas that were not submerged. Many of these individuals were rural residents who continued their agricultural activities in the new locations.  Cross-Province Resettlement:  Another portion of the migrants was relocated to other provinces. Major destination provinces included economically developed coastal areas like Shanghai, Jiangsu, Zhejiang, Guangdong, and Fujian, as well as nearby regions in Sichuan and Chongqing. Cross-province resettlement often provided new job opportunities, and some migrants received vocational training to help them adapt to their new environments.  Urban Resettlement:  To make better use of labor resources, some migrants were resettled in cities like Chongqing, Wuhan, and Yichang, where they received urban residency status and job placements in factories or service industries. This group of migrants transitioned from traditional agricultural roles to urban livelihoods, entering the industrial and service sectors and adapting to city life.  Voluntary Migration:  A number of migrants chose their own destinations after receiving compensation. Many opted to relocate to economically developed areas such as the Pearl River Delta and Yangtze River Delta regions, seeking job and development opportunities on their own.  The Three Gorges resettlement was an extensive initiative, involving significant policy support, funding, and training measures to help migrants adjust to their new environments.
